Huckle's off to do Mother Cat's shopping for the first time when he forgets the list. Huckle's sure he knows what to get so he and Lowly buy potato chips instead of potatoes, orange soda instead of oranges, etc. Mother Cat didn't want party food - until Aunt Rose and Lily arrive for a party Mother Cat had forgotten about. The Police Chief gives urgent orders to Sneef and his assistant Sniff - they must hurry to Nice. Sneef's sure there's a big crime to stop, and everyone on the train is suspect. After a sleepless night watching various "scoundrels" get on the train, the scoundrels are revealed to be police chiefs who've gotten together to throw Sneef a surprise birthday party.
Huckle and Lowly camp in the backyard but after Kenny tells them a ghost story, they're sure they see a huge claw in the shadows. They sleep inside, and then sneak back outside the next morning pretending to have spent the night there. Father Cat tells them the story of when he slept outside - he thought he saw a huge claw too - but it was just a leaf rake.
